The Unexpected Allergy: Understanding Chicken Allergy

Chicken, a dietary staple across the globe, is surprisingly a common allergen for some individuals. While not as prevalent as allergies to peanuts, milk, or eggs, a chicken allergy can significantly impact a person's life, requiring careful attention to diet and avoidance strategies. This article delves into the complexities of chicken allergy, exploring its causes, symptoms, diagnosis, management, and the potential for future research and treatments.

What is a Chicken Allergy?

A chicken allergy is an adverse immune response triggered by proteins found in chicken meat. When a person with a chicken allergy consumes even a small amount of chicken, their immune system mistakenly identifies these proteins as harmful invaders. This triggers the release of antibodies, specifically immunoglobulin E (IgE), which then initiates a cascade of reactions leading to various allergic symptoms. The severity of these reactions can range from mild discomfort to life-threatening anaphylaxis. It's important to note that the allergy isn't to the bird itself, but specifically to the proteins within the chicken meat. This means that feathers, droppings, or contact with live chickens may not necessarily cause a reaction in those allergic to chicken meat.

Causes and Risk Factors:

The precise mechanisms behind chicken allergies are not fully understood, but several factors are believed to contribute:

  • Genetic Predisposition: A family history of allergies, particularly food allergies, significantly increases the risk of developing a chicken allergy. This suggests a genetic component plays a role in how the immune system responds to certain proteins.

  • Early Exposure: While the hygiene hypothesis suggests that limited early exposure to allergens can increase the risk of allergy development, the evidence regarding chicken allergy and early exposure is less conclusive. Some research suggests that early introduction of chicken to an infant's diet might offer some protection, but more studies are needed to confirm this.

  • Other Allergies: Individuals with allergies to other foods, especially eggs, are at a higher risk of developing a chicken allergy. This is because some proteins in chicken share similar structures to those found in eggs, leading to cross-reactivity. This means that the immune system, sensitized to egg proteins, might also react to similar proteins in chicken.

  • Age of Onset: Chicken allergies can develop at any age, but they are most commonly diagnosed in early childhood. However, the allergy can also manifest later in life, potentially triggered by a significant change in diet or exposure to chicken in a new way.

Symptoms of a Chicken Allergy:

The symptoms of a chicken allergy are diverse and depend on the severity of the reaction. Symptoms can range from mild to severe and can manifest in various parts of the body.

  • Mild Symptoms: These might include itching in the mouth or throat, hives (urticaria), mild swelling of the lips or face, nasal congestion, and a runny nose. These symptoms are generally uncomfortable but rarely life-threatening.

  • Moderate Symptoms: More severe reactions can include vomiting, diarrhea, abdominal cramps, difficulty breathing (wheezing), and a drop in blood pressure. These symptoms require prompt medical attention.

  • Severe Symptoms (Anaphylaxis): This is a life-threatening emergency characterized by difficulty breathing, swelling of the throat and tongue, rapid heart rate, dizziness, loss of consciousness, and shock. Anaphylaxis requires immediate medical treatment with epinephrine (adrenaline) and emergency transport to a hospital.

Diagnosis of Chicken Allergy:

Diagnosing a chicken allergy typically involves a combination of methods:

  • Medical History: A thorough medical history, including details about symptoms, exposure to chicken, and family history of allergies, is crucial.

  • Skin Prick Test: This involves pricking the skin with a small amount of chicken extract. A positive reaction (wheal and flare) indicates an allergic response.

  • Blood Test (RAST): A blood test measures the level of IgE antibodies specific to chicken proteins. This test can be useful when skin prick testing is inconclusive or contraindicated.

  • Food Challenge: In some cases, a controlled food challenge under medical supervision might be necessary to confirm the diagnosis. This involves gradually increasing the amount of chicken consumed while closely monitoring for any reactions.

Managing a Chicken Allergy:

The cornerstone of managing a chicken allergy is strict avoidance of all chicken products. This requires careful reading of food labels and being aware of hidden sources of chicken in processed foods, sauces, and condiments. Individuals with chicken allergies should also carry an epinephrine auto-injector (like an EpiPen) in case of accidental exposure and anaphylaxis. Other management strategies include:

  • Careful Food Label Reading: Always check food labels carefully, as chicken might be an ingredient in unexpected products.

  • Restaurant Awareness: When eating out, inform restaurant staff about the allergy and inquire about preparation methods to minimize cross-contamination.

  • Emergency Plan: Develop an emergency plan in case of accidental exposure, including knowing where the nearest emergency room is and having readily available epinephrine.

  • Anaphylaxis Education: Learn how to administer epinephrine and recognize the signs of anaphylaxis.

Future Research and Treatments:

While avoiding chicken is currently the primary management strategy, research is ongoing to explore potential treatments for food allergies. These include:

  • Immunotherapy: This involves gradually introducing small amounts of chicken protein to desensitize the immune system over time. While promising, it's still under development for chicken allergies.

  • New Diagnostic Tools: Improved diagnostic tools are being developed to provide more accurate and efficient ways to identify chicken allergy.
